What Is The Outer Skin Of Sausage. Casing is a term used to describe the outer covering of meat products such as sausages, bologna, salami, pepperoni, bacon, ham, and other types of processed meats. Most sausages are made by forcing chopped or ground meat, fat, and seasonings into a skin of sorts (called the casing), which then gets tied or twisted to create individual links. Casing is usually made from the intestine of a cow, pig, sheep, goat, or deer. In the past, sausage was produced using naturally available.
